## Service Accounts — Faremark Rules Engine

The Faremark rules engine evaluates shipping-fee rules for checkout. Each consuming service uses a dedicated service account with read-only scope; rule edits require the separate authoring role. Accounts are reviewed quarterly and unused ones disabled. For the staging evaluation account discussed in this week's sync, the key is listed below.

API key for fahip-kahip: zpat23_XiJGUHz5xfaAtaIqUkus0rh

Ticket IDX-2093: Requesting reviewer sign-off before we unseal the Marrowfield vault. Background: the autocomplete index for Lanternquery has degraded to 900ms p95, and the tuning credentials needed to rebuild the shard weights are stored in that vault, which auto-locked after the quarterly rotation lapsed. The rebuild patch itself is in branch idx-rebalance and looks sound, but the migration step cannot run without vault access. Please review the diff and the unseal justification together. For the unseal step, the recovery passphrase follows.

recovery phrase for bawef-haduf: wenax-druox-julmir

## Deploying the Gatewick Proctor Queue

Deploys are pretty painless: push to main, wait for the pipeline, then watch the queue drain dashboard for five minutes. If candidates pile up mid-exam, roll back first and ask questions later — the queue replays safely. Everything the workers care about lives in one config block, shown here for reference.

settings of bafof-yagef:
JOROX_PIN=8740
JOROX_TENANT=pelox
JOROX_METRICS_HOST=metrics.jorox.qorvelworks.internal
JOROX_SEAL=seal_c78f63c1
JOROX_STANDBY_TEAM=norax